5 Essential Spring Roofing Maintenance Tips to Prevent Costly Repairs

Spring is the perfect time for homeowners to inspect and maintain their
roofs after the harsh winter months. Neglecting roof maintenance can
lead to expensive repairs and even premature roof replacement. By
following these five essential spring roofing maintenance tips, you can
extend the lifespan of your roof and keep your home protected.

1. Inspect Your Roof for Winter Damage

San Antonio and South Texas experience unpredictable winter weather,
including high winds, heavy rain, and occasional ice. These elements can
cause significant damage to your roof, leading to missing shingles,
cracks, and sagging areas. Be sure to check for loose or damaged
shingles, signs of moisture buildup, and weakened flashing around
chimneys and vents. Addressing these issues early can help prevent
costly roofing repairs down the road.

2. Clean Your Gutters and Downspouts

Clogged gutters are a major cause of roof leaks and water damage.
Leaves, twigs, and other debris can block proper drainage, forcing water
to back up under your shingles. To avoid damage to both your roof and
foundation, clean out your gutters and downspouts at the start of
spring. Installing gutter guards can also help prevent future clogs and
keep water flowing smoothly away from your home.

3. Check for Leaks and Water Stains

Water stains on your ceiling or walls could indicate a hidden roof leak.
Even small leaks can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and wood
rot if left untreated. Inspect your attic for damp insulation, musty
odors, and visible water stains. If you notice any of these warning
signs, call a trusted roofing contractor in San Antonio to assess and
repair the damage before it worsens.

4. Trim Overhanging Tree Branches

Spring storms and strong winds can cause tree branches to scrape against
your roof, damaging shingles and flashing. Overgrown branches also
provide an easy pathway for pests like squirrels and raccoons to access
your home. Trim back any overhanging limbs to prevent roof damage and
improve your home’s overall safety.
